... a fracture of the ball joint in her left shoulder. She hurt herself in a fall at home on Monday.

A nasty fracture. I had two fractures in my right shoulder (but not the ball joint) from a fall a few days before Christmas 2016. No surgery was required but a full shoulder restraint was required for six-weeks. It requires assistance for everything except eating and writing (if left handed). I recovered and now have full motion but as a single man needed in-home help for dressing, washing, bathing, etc. It was very embarrassing to be treated as a complete invalid.

Though I disagree with her positions, I do wish her a speedy recovery.
